In the kaleidoscope of Indian ethnic wear, Anarkali suits stand out as timeless classics, embodying grace, elegance, and tradition. Their mesmerizing silhouette, adorned with intricate embroidery and rich fabrics, makes them a favorite choice for various occasions, from weddings to festive celebrations. With the convenience of online shopping, purchasing the perfect Anarkali suit has never been easier. However, navigating the vast array of options can be overwhelming. Fear not! Here are some expert tips to ensure a seamless and satisfying shopping experience:
-
Know Your Measurements: Before embarking on your online shopping journey, it's essential to accurately measure yourself. Pay attention to bust, waist, hip, and length measurements to ensure a perfect fit. Many online retailers provide size charts, so take advantage of them to select the right size.
-
Research and Compare: With numerous online stores offering Anarkali suits, it's crucial to research and compare products, prices, and reviews. Look for reputable sellers known for their quality and customer service. Reading customer feedback can provide valuable insights into the product's quality, fit, and overall satisfaction.
-
Fabric Matters: The fabric choice can significantly impact the look and feel of an Anarkali suit. Opt for breathable fabrics like cotton or georgette for casual wear and lightweight comfort. For special occasions, indulge in luxurious fabrics like silk, velvet, or chiffon, known for their regal appeal and drape.
-
Embroidery and Embellishments: Anarkali suits are renowned for their exquisite embroidery and embellishments, adding a touch of opulence to the attire. Pay attention to the type of embroidery—whether it's intricate zari work, resham embroidery, or delicate sequin embellishments. Choose embellishments that complement the occasion and your personal style.
-
Customization Options: Many online retailers offer customization options, allowing you to personalize your Anarkali suit according to your preferences. From sleeve length to neckline style, explore customization features to create a bespoke ensemble that reflects your unique style statement.
-
Check Return Policies: Despite your best efforts, there's always a chance of the outfit not meeting your expectations. Before making a purchase, familiarize yourself with the seller's return and exchange policies. Ensure they offer hassle-free returns and refunds in case the product doesn't match the description or fit as expected.
-
Accessorize Wisely: Complete your Anarkali look with carefully chosen accessories that enhance its beauty and elegance. Opt for statement jewelry pieces like jhumkas, chokers, or kadas to complement the outfit's neckline and embroidery. A matching clutch or potli bag adds the perfect finishing touch to your ethnic ensemble.

Ethnic wear for women transcends boundaries of time and trends, embodying the rich cultural heritage and sartorial splendor of India. From traditional sarees and salwar kameez to contemporary fusion ensembles, the realm of ethnic wear offers a myriad of options to suit every taste and occasion. Whether you're attending a festive celebration, a wedding ceremony, or simply embracing your cultural roots, here are some inspiring ideas to elevate your ethnic wardrobe:
-
Saree Sensation: Embrace the timeless elegance of the saree, a symbol of grace and femininity. Opt for classic silk sarees like Banarasi, Kanjivaram, or Chanderi for a regal appeal, or choose lightweight fabrics like georgette or chiffon for effortless draping and comfort. Experiment with different draping styles and embellishments to create a look that's uniquely yours.
-
Salwar Kameez Chic: Discover the versatility of the salwar kameez, a traditional ensemble that combines comfort with sophistication. Choose from an array of styles, including Anarkali suits, straight-cut salwar suits, or palazzo sets, adorned with intricate embroidery, embellishments, or printed motifs. Mix and match contrasting colors and patterns to create eye-catching ensembles that exude charm and elegance.
-
Lehenga Love: Make a statement with a stunning lehenga ensemble, perfect for weddings, receptions, and festive occasions. Opt for traditional lehengas embellished with intricate embroidery, zari work, or stone embellishments for a royal look. Experiment with different blouse styles, from traditional cholis to contemporary crop tops, to add a modern twist to this timeless silhouette.
-
Fusion Finesse: Embrace the fusion trend by combining traditional ethnic elements with contemporary styles. Experiment with Indo-western ensembles like dhoti pants paired with crop tops, or sarees styled with jackets or belts for a fashion-forward look. Mix traditional handloom fabrics with modern silhouettes to create eclectic outfits that seamlessly blend tradition with trendiness.
-
Accessorize with Panache: Elevate your ethnic ensemble with carefully chosen accessories that enhance its beauty and allure. Opt for statement jewelry pieces like chandbalis, kundan necklaces, or temple jewelry sets to complement your outfit. Complete your look with embellished clutches, potli bags, or embroidered juttis for a touch of ethnic charm.
